The Process

How Does It Work?

Steps 01–02 are the free prototype phase
01 Days 1–2

Scoping Conversation

Our Senior Leadership or a Senior Architect reviews your requirements, goals, and constraints. For EdTech projects, compliance requirements — FERPA, COPPA, WCAG — are surfaced in this session, not after the proposal. You leave with a clear sense of feasibility, timeline, and what a prototype would demonstrate.

FERPA · COPPA · WCAG No commitment required
02 Days 3–5

Free Working Prototype & Detailed Proposal

We build a functional proof-of-concept demonstrating our core architecture approach and feature flow. Alongside it, we deliver a full written proposal: scope, resource plan, fixed price, and sprint-by-sprint timeline. You review both before signing anything. The prototype is yours to keep regardless of what happens next.

Free prototype Fixed price Yours to keep
03 Kickoff

Agreement & Kickoff

Once the proposal and prototype are approved, we finalize the agreement and launch the project. Your engineering team is in your tools before the end of week one. IP transfer and data handling terms are confirmed in the agreement — everything Hireplicity builds is yours.

Full IP transfer In your tools by week 1
04 Ongoing

Fortnightly Sprint Demos

Every two weeks, you see working software — not a status report. A 30-minute demo of everything shipped in the sprint, open to your whole team. Issues are flagged in the demo, not discovered at delivery.

Working software every 2 weeks Open to your whole team
05 Continuous

Continuous QA — AI-Assisted

Our QA engineers run manual and AI-generated test suites in parallel with development — not at the end. 80–85% automated test coverage on every sprint's output. For EdTech clients: FERPA data handling and WCAG 2.1 AA accessibility checks run on every release candidate.

AI-assisted 80–85% coverage WCAG 2.1 AA FERPA verified
06 Delivery

Final Delivery & Approval

The completed product is delivered to your environment and reviewed against the original scope document. All feedback cycles are completed before sign-off. Nothing is marked closed until you confirm it meets the agreed specification.

Reviewed against scope doc Your sign-off required
07 Closure

Project Closure & Full Handoff Documentation

Architecture decision record, codebase walkthrough, deployment runbook, and a 30-day post-launch support window — all included. Your team can own and maintain the product independently from day one.

ADR + runbook Codebase walkthrough 30-day support included
08 Post-launch

Continue or Transition — Your Choice

After the 30-day support window, you can move to a Dedicated Pod for ongoing development, engage us for a follow-on project, or take the codebase fully in-house. All intellectual property transfers to you in full — no retained licenses, no proprietary dependencies.
